Output d7a2c84b39af9a0c91a52851f6ef397026f8138d718b167ca54f929559867845:0

value
407801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b51213953d5c363dc2a3dcdd36f199ab43c6fed OP_EQUAL
address
34BTMifahw8cyaZqQ5A5hcg5rBBaDhg9A2
transaction
d7a2c84b39af9a0c91a52851f6ef397026f8138d718b167ca54f929559867845
spent
true